Joe McCann, Staff Captain Official I.R.A., was born in Belfast in 1947. He was active in Republican political and military activities from the age of 14. In the mid 1960s he was arrested and served a year in prison for Republican military activities. When violence broke out in 1969 against Civil Rights artivists in the north of Ireland Joe was in the forefront in thier defence, and in offece against the British Army. Joe was a true Socialist Rebel. He had no interest in preserving the artificial divide among the Irish Working Class that had been instituted and maintained by British Imperialism. His exploits in action were legendary. This song was written by Eamonn O'Doherty, well known Republican Socialist activist, author, artist, educator, architecht and sculptor. There is one error made by the singer in this recording of the song. The line should go "...he carried NO gun..." as even the British military admit that Big Joe was unarmed when he was shot down in Joy Street on 15 April 1972. He had been identified by Belfast Special Branch detectives who passed this information on to the Parachute Regiment of the British Army who shot him down. After he had been incapacitated he was shot ten times at close range while he lay helpless on the pavement. In his brutal murder the British Army paid him the highest compliment...he was too dangerous to be allowed to live.
